PENUELAS-RUBIO, Ofelda et al. Larrea tridentata extracts as an ecological strategy against Fusarium oxysporum radicis-lycopersici in tomato plants under greenhouse conditions. Rev. mex. fitopatol [online]. 2017, vol.35, n.3, pp.360-376. ISSN 2007-8080.  https://doi.org/10.18781/r.mex.fit.1703-3.

The antifungal ability of extracts of Larrea tridentata in the inhibition of Fusarium oxysporum radicis-lycopersici in vitro and in vivo was evaluated. Once the Fusarium strain was characterized, the methodology of poisoned culture medium was used to determine the inhibition of mycelial growth at various concentrations (0-2000 ppm) and solvents (dichloromethane, methanol, ethanol and water). In the in vivo assay, ten treatments were evaluated: 2000 and 3000 ppm for DCM and EtOH, 3000 and 6000 ppm for MeOH and H2O and two controls; one plant as experimental unit and ten replicates. Plant height, leaf number, chlorophyll, severity, as well as incidence and survival were determined in tomato plants inoculated with the fungus and different extracts of L. tridentata. The extracts with a higher percentage of inhibition and vegetative development are dichloromethane at 3000 ppm and methanol at 4000 ppm, both in vitro and in vivo. Extracts of Larrea tridentata can be considered as part of an integrated management plan for the control of crown rot in tomatoes caused by Fusarium oxysporum radicis-lycopersici.
